Is a dog food comparison really necessary? Most pet owners believe that any brand of dog food available on a store shelf will provide complete nutrition, and everything needed for a happy and healthy pet. Unfortunately this is not true. There are many dog foods out there that are not nutritionally adequate. Some foods use poor quality sources to save money, and others may skimp on certain ingredients as a cost cutting measure.

If you own a dog then you want to provide the best food possible. What your pet eats will determine how healthy the dog is and how often a vet is needed. Some of the best dog foods available are top quality and provide complete nutritional support for canines, but many of these brands can be very expensive and may require a special trip to the vet to purchase. There are some commercial brands that may offer the same nutrition and quality for less.

A dog food comparison should always be performed, to ensure that your pet is getting all the nutrients and calories needed for good health and optimal fitness. In some cases a vet recommended special diet may be needed due to certain medical conditions or health problems. Most dogs do not require a special diet though, and the higher cost of vet brands may be unnecessary.

The first factor that should be evaluated and compared with any dog food is the list of ingredients that go into the food. Choose brands that list high quality protein sources near the top. Ingredients are listed in order by amount, going from ingredients that are used the most to those ingredients that may only be included in very small amounts. Many brands may include fruits and vegetables to ensure complete nutrition, and these brands should also list these ingredients near the top.

Any dog food comparison that is made should include many factors. The price, the ingredient list, any additives or preservatives used, and the quality of the food sources all need to be examined closely. Any recommendations from the vet should also be considered when comparing different foods and brands. This comparison will help you choose the best food for your pet and your budget.
